Key Features & Benefits at a Glance
- High tensile strength of 120,000 psi ensures reliable performance in demanding applications, reducing the risk of fastener failure.
- Zinc plating provides corrosion resistance, extending the service life of the screw in various environmental conditions.
- Grade 5 classification and Rockwell C25 hardness offer excellent durability and resistance to wear under heavy loads.
- UNC coarse thread design allows for quicker installation and better grip in softer materials or where vibration is a concern.
- Fully threaded shank provides consistent holding power along the entire length, ideal for adjustable or deep-set applications.
- Class 2A thread fit ensures easy assembly while maintaining secure fastening, minimizing production delays.
- External hex drive and hex head design enable straightforward installation with common tools, improving efficiency in industrial settings.
Professional Applications & Engineering Value
This Grade 5 hex head screw is engineered from zinc plated steel to address common industrial challenges such as corrosion and high-stress fatigue. Its UNC coarse thread and fully threaded design provide superior grip and vibration resistance, making it ideal for heavy-duty applications in construction, machinery assembly, and automotive sectors. The combination of 120,000 psi tensile strength and precise Class 2A thread fit ensures reliable fastening in dynamic environments, reducing maintenance needs and enhancing structural integrity for long-term projects.
Specification Summary & Compliance
This product adheres to Class 2A thread fit tolerances and UNC coarse thread standards, manufactured in compliance with ASME B18.2.1 and SAE J429 specifications. It meets RoHS 3 (2015/863/EU) requirements, ensuring environmental safety and regulatory conformity for industrial use.
